| Cake Style | Key Visual Features | Best For | Typical Price Range |
|---|---|---|---|
| Classic Sheet Cake | Simple tiers, solid colors, minimal decorations | Casual family gatherings | $30–$80 |
| Fondant Masterpiece | Smooth finish, sculpted figures, glossy appearance | Formal events and photo shoots | $120–$500+ |
| Naked Cake | Exposed crumb, fresh fruit, rustic charm | Outdoor and garden celebrations | $90–$250 |
| Themed Spectacular | Custom murals, licensed characters, coordinated props | Children’s birthdays and branded events | $200–$1000+ |

Baking and Structural Considerations
Baking and structural considerations become critical when you work with pictures of big birthday cakes that need to support multiple tiers. Cakes over eight inches tall often require internal dowels and sturdy boards to prevent shifting.
Bakers often use dense sponge cakes or reinforced cake boards to handle the weight of frosting and sculpted elements. Proper refrigeration during transport and display helps maintain sharp edges and stable shapes for photo opportunities.

Photography and Presentation Tips
Photography and presentation tips help ensure that pictures of big birthday cakes look their best in every setting. Use soft, diffused lighting to highlight texture without washing out colors or creating harsh shadows.
Position the cake against a neutral backdrop and add complementary props like candles, cutlery, and themed décor to enhance the narrative. Capturing close-ups of intricate details and wide shots that show the full arrangement tells the complete story of the celebration.

What are the main factors that affect the price of a big birthday cake?
Price is influenced by complexity of design, ingredient quality, baker reputation, and delivery requirements, with larger size and intricate detailing typically increasing the cost.
Can a big birthday cake be made gluten-free or vegan without sacrificing style?
Yes, specialty bakeries can replicate elaborate designs using gluten-free or vegan formulas, though ingredient substitutions may slightly alter texture and require careful structural support.
How far in advance should I order a custom big birthday cake for a milestone celebration?
For milestone celebrations, placing an order four to six weeks ahead is ideal, especially for highly detailed designs or during peak event seasons.
